Flying Golden Tree Snake

Chrysopelea ornata

Description:

A beautiful slim snake. About a meter long. Its main colour is green with black markings. Its belly is yellowish. It is very curious and not at all aggressive. It is venomous but not dangerous to men.

Habitat:

I noticed it dropping itself of our roof onto a banana leaf and sliding downwards towards the ground. It stayed in the tree for quite some time. It was the middle of the day. Our garden has many banana trees, rubber trees and grass. It is comfortable around people as we have been finding its skin in our garage.

Notes:

I heard some common minah birds making a lot of noise and when I investigated I saw this snake dropping onto the banana tree. We have spotted it for the first time 4.5 years ago when it was a baby , and have been finding his/her skin in the garage ever since. :-) The skin gets bigger every time. I have never seen it glide :-(
